Brava Energia announces new Offshore Operations Director

BRAVA ENERGIA S.A. (“BRAVA” or “Company”) (B3: BRAV3), in compliance with the provisions of CVM Resolution No. 44 and the Novo Mercado Regulation, and complementing the Material Fact disclosed on January 30, 2024, hereby informs its shareholders and the market in general that, on this date, Mr. Carlos José do Nascimento Travassos has assumed the position of Offshore Operations Officer, following the ratification of his appointment as Statutory Officer by the Board of Directors, replacing Mr. Carlos Ferraz Mastrangelo.

Mr. Travassos holds a degree in Mechanical Engineering and a postgraduate degree in Business Management in Oil & Gas and Renewable Energy. Mr. Travassos has 39 years of experience and held the position of Vice President of Investment and Digital Technologies at Braskem until December 2024. Prior to that, he built his career both in Brazil and abroad at Petrobras, where he acted for 35 years, in addition to four years in the Naval Construction segment with the Brazilian Navy. Throughout his career at Petrobras, Mr. Travassos held several leadership positions, including Executive Director of Engineering, Technology and Innovation, Executive Manager of Deepwater Operations, and Executive Manager of Surface Systems, Refining, Gas, and Energy. Among his key contributions are: (i) the management of exploration and production projects, including pre-salt production systems; (ii) the management of refinery projects, as well as logistics and natural gas infrastructure; (iii) leadership in technology development through Petrobras’ Research Center; and (iv) leadership in the development and operation of deepwater fields in the Campos and Espírito Santo Basins.

During his tenure as Offshore Operations Officer, Mr. Mastrangelo’s experience in Exploration and Production development projects, particularly involving floating production units (FPSOs), was instrumental in enabling BRAVA to become the first independent oil and gas company in the country to develop a deepwater production system from its initial phase. BRAVA extends its gratitude to Mr. Mastrangelo for his dedication and significant contributions to the company and wishes him continued success in his professional journey.
